当前位置: 代码迷 >> J2EE >> 数据库 单引号'和双引号"该如何解决
  详细解决方案

数据库 单引号'和双引号"该如何解决

热度:594   发布时间:2016-04-22 03:31:57.0
数据库 单引号'和双引号"
怎么理解数据库操作的SQL语句的"和'
我搞混淆了 
请前辈来指导指导?????????????
Thank you!!!!!!!!!!!!

------解决方案--------------------
字符串都是单引号。

双引号很少用,按找ansi标准,双引号用在标识符上,比如表名、字段名。但一般都用不着用,只有当标识符是SQL保留字时必须用。比如表名叫 SELECT,字段名叫 FROM。
------解决方案--------------------
数据库里单引号是特殊意义的, 双引号没有特殊意义!
------解决方案--------------------
续一楼说法.
简单说:你可以创建带""号的表或者字段
例:create table "from" select * from "from"
而单引号:用于字段为字符或时间的值
例:insert into Test values('姓名',年龄,'日期')
char类型的好像可用也可不用''
------解决方案--------------------
单引号还是SQL里的转义字符。
------解决方案--------------------
双引号和正常字符是一样的,而单引号则是引用字符的...
  相关解决方案